The Delmarva Central Railroad Company (DCR), a subsidiary of CEI, operates 188 miles of rail line in Delaware, Maryland, and Virginia and is managed locally from offices in Harrington, Delaware. But in 2015, VA set up the Veterans Experience Office to begin to address the way veterans’ needs were met. In 2018, the Office of Management and Budget made VA a lead agency partner to pilot improving CX across the federal government. Agencies had their rules, and constituents had to navigate them to get the services they needed.

DC received a scathing report from HUD about the failures in managing the city's public housing stock of 8,000 units, 25%--2,000-are vacant because most are uninhabitable (" D.C. It attributed the issue to management failure and said the vacancies have accelerated the agency’s steadily deteriorating financial condition.
